Fly angling is a technique of fishing making use of an artificial "fly." The fly is cast making use of a fly rod, reel, and specialized weighted line. Casting an almost weightless fly or "lure" needs spreading methods substantially different from various other kinds of casting. In spin spreading, the weight of the lure pulls the line off the reel.

Fly fishing is most typically connected with trout angling however it has acquired appeal with fishermens angling from whatever from largemouth bass and bluegill to big-game deep sea types - Fishing Accessories. Fishing pole been available in different weights for the function of casting a particular weight line. The size number of the fishing pole is directly linked to the size or variety of the fly line planned to be cast

The bigger the number, the larger the rod and the much heavier the line the pole will certainly cast. When the fly is also heavy for the line, the line sags and the cast doesn't make it.

For general freshwater angling for Illinois species a 6 or 7 weight rod and line will certainly work perfectly. As you become more advanced, you can include bigger or smaller sized weight poles to tailor you fishing experience to trout, crappie, bass, carp, etc. Beginning with a mid-weight (5 or 6 weight) fishing pole, fly line of the exact same weight, and fly reel.

When this occurs you can connect on new tippet product. As a suggestion to all anglers, the inappropriate usage and disposal of fishing line can have a dramatic effect on our wild animals. Inappropriately thrown out monofilament often builds up in preferred fishing locations and might entangle around boat props and aquatic life, while taking over 500 years to decay.

Abandoned line can "ghost fish" by remaining to capture aquatic types (e.g., fish, turtles and birds) More hints in makeshift nets for years (Fishing Accessories). As a tip to all fishermens, the you could try here improper use and disposal of fishing line can have a significant influence on our wildlife. Many shore birds, migratory birds, waterfowl and raptors have come to be entangle in monofilament and died

Make use of the appropriate examination line for the wanted fish and angling method Replace monofilament yearly to decrease the opportunity of damaging the line. Take the effort while taking pleasure in Illinois waters grab any disposed of monofilament and tackle you see along the shore. Advertise the usage of Monofilament recycling containers and encourage the collection and recycling of monofilament line.
